Local driver sees passenger numbers increase after authorities crack down on Malaysian ‘pirate cars’
Malaysian “pirate cars” have been found offering not just cross-border trips but also point-to-point services, even allowing tourists to “book the whole car” for the day. This has been eating into the business of local taxis, private hire cars, and limousine drivers.
